Charna Island is a small island located near Karachi, Pakistan. Charna Island is a small uninhabited island located in the Arabian Sea, about 9 km (5.6 mi) west of the mouth of the Hub River, It is approximately 1.2 km (0.75 mi) long and 0.5 km (0.31 mi) wide. Marine life around this island includes yellow-bellied ocean snake, incredible barracuda, limit banned Spanish mackerel, cobia, mahi-mahi, skipjack fish, angle fish, ocean urchin, ocean fan, shellfish, beam angle and uncommon green turtle.

Snorkeling:

A typical action performed in warm deep water, resorts, islands, shorelines and essentially anyplace where submerged attractions are recognizable. It doesn’t requires any extra or special equipments. The most important thing that is required is a snorkel (a short J-shaped tube that enables clients to breath while their face is in water), which enables the diver to perceive what is in the water underneath.

Scuba Diving:

It is simply a form of underwater diving with some special breathing equipment. Stands for Self-Contained Underwater Breathing Apparatus. It is awesome because it is total immersion in the ocean. it doesn’t require any sort of dedicated training however, but the good news is that this training takes just a couple of hours to understand before you can start exploring. Most of the trainers use signed language inside for words like “all is fine”, “Some problem in breathing”, “take me up” etc etc.

The persons entire body is under the water. The diver’s face (nose and eyes) are covered using a diving mask; You simply cannot breathe in through the nose, you have inhale and exhale air from your mouth-piece that is attached to the oxygen cylinder that is behind your back, except you are wearing a special full face diving mask.
